Description

Double Snowdrop is a charming bulbous perennial admired for its elegant double white flowers and early-season blooms. It is ideal for woodland gardens, borders, rock gardens, naturalized landscapes, and container displays. This cold-hardy plant thrives in partial shade to full sun and prefers moist, well-drained soil rich in organic matter. Its delicate double blooms emerge in late winter to early spring, bringing beauty and seasonal interest to the garden when few other plants are flowering.

Specifications

  • Scientific Name: Galanthus nivalis f. pleniflorus (or related double-flowered Galanthus selections)
  • Common Name (US): Double Snowdrop
  • Seed Type / Variety: Double Flowered Variety
  • Growth Habit: Bulbous perennial
  • USDA Zones: 3-8
  • Planting Season: Fall
  • Growing Season: Late Winter through Spring
  • Sowing Season: Fall (September-November)
  • Sowing Season Months: September, October, November
  • Germination Time and Conditions: 30-90 days; cold stratification recommended for improved germination
  • Sunlight Requirements: Partial shade to full sun
  • Soil Requirements: Moist, well-drained soil rich in organic matter
  • Watering Needs: Moderate; maintain lightly moist soil during active growth
  • Mature Plant Size: 4-8 inches tall, 3-6 inches spread
  • Plant Spacing: 3-4 inches apart
